Teachers must assume their role and search for the best activities, strategies and materials for their students; hence, it is an unfinished (never ending?) task for them to explore all the possibilities in order to fulfill students’ expectations of learning. According to the text length, Hill (1994:15) points out three other basic criteria of choosing the text: “(1) the needs and abilities of the students; (2) the linguistic and stylistic level of the text; (3) the amount of background information required for a true appreciation of the material.” Therefore, teachers can do a diagnosis of the students’ level of language and likes in terms of reading; it will permit them to select the appropriate material, and the activities are going to be meaningful for students.
